What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ote medical coder,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Medical Coder, you need a solid understanding of medical terminology, anatomy, and coding systems such as ICD-10 and CPT, usually supported by a coding certification (e.g., CPC, CCS). Familiarity with electronic health records (EHRs) and coding software like 3M or Epic is essential for accurate and efficient work. Attention to detail, time management, and strong written communication skills help remote coders excel in independent, deadline-driven environments. These abilities ensure accurate billing, compliance with regulations, and minimal claim denials, which are critical for healthcare organizations' operational and financial success.

What is the difference between Remote Medical Coder vs Remote Medical Biller?

AspectRemote Medical CoderRemote Medical Biller
CertificationsCertified Professional Coder (CPC), CCSCertified Medical Reimbursement Specialist (CMRS), CPC
Work EnvironmentAnalyzing medical records, coding diagnoses and proceduresSubmitting claims, following up on payments
Industry UsageHealthcare providers, hospitals, clinicsInsurance companies, billing services, healthcare providers

Remote Medical Coders and Remote Medical Billers often work together but focus on different tasks. Coders assign codes based on medical records, while Billers handle claims submission and payment follow-up. Both roles require similar certifications and are essential in healthcare revenue cycle management.

What is a remote medical coder?

A remote medical coder is a healthcare professional who reviews clinical documents and assigns standardized codes for diagnoses, procedures, and medical services, all while working from a remote location such as their home. These codes are essential for billing, insurance claims, and maintaining patient records. Remote medical coders typically use electronic health records (EHR) and must have a strong understanding of medical terminology, coding systems like ICD-10 and CPT, and relevant regulations. Working remotely offers flexibility but still requires attention to detail, confidentiality, and adherence to industry standards.

What does a remote medical coder do?

Remote medical coders are medical coders who work from home or locations outside of healthcare facilities. They process patient information, such as diagnosis, services rendered, and equipment used to conduct tests, in order to translate it into medical codes consisting of numbers and letters. Billing and coding specialists manage this information so that patients or their insurance companies can be billed appropriately. Remote medical coders may be self-employed or work for large coding firms that contract with hospitals or healthcare facilities.

The Medical Bill Examiner III is an experienced claims professional responsible for the accurate review, analysis, and adjudication of complex medical bills. This role applies advanced knowledge of medical billing practices, coding standards, fee schedules, and regulatory requirements to ensure compliance, accuracy, and cost containment. The Med Bill Examiner III functions with a high level of independence and may serve as a subject matter resource for lowerlevel examiners.

Start Date: September 14, 2026
Hours: 8:00 AM - 5:00 PM / Monday-Friday Eastern Time Zone

Key Responsibilities

  • Review, audit, and adjudicate complex medical bills for accuracy, medical necessity, and compliance with applicable fee schedules, contracts, and regulations.

  • Analyze CPT, HCPCS, ICD codes and supporting documentation to identify discrepancies, overbilling, duplicate charges, or noncovered services.

  • Apply statespecific guidelines, provider contracts, and internal policies when determining appropriate reimbursement.

  • Document billing determinations clearly and thoroughly to ensure audit readiness and compliance.

  • Communicate billing outcomes, discrepancies, or requests for additional documentation to internal partners, providers, or vendors.

  • Resolve billing disputes and escalated issues using sound judgment and investigative analysis.

  • Maintain productivity and quality standards in a highvolume environment.

  • Support process improvements and contribute to consistency and best practices across the medical bill review function.

  • May mentor or provide guidance to Medical Bill Examiner I or II staff.

Qualifications

  • Advanced experience in medical bill review, claims adjudication, or medical billing audit.

  • Strong working knowledge of medical coding (CPT, HCPCS, ICD), fee schedules, and billing regulations

  • Certified Professional Coder (CPC).

  • Demonstrated analytical, investigative, and criticalthinking skills.

  • High attention to detail with strong documentation discipline.

  • Ability to manage workload independently while meeting accuracy and turnaround expectations.

  • Effective written and verbal communication skills.

  • Comfort handling complex or disputed billing scenarios.
